How to Improve Customer Insights with Video Content Analytics
The field of video content
analytics has seen a
meteoric rise in popularity among businesses, particularly when it comes to the
extraction of brand insights through the analysis of customer sentiment derived
from various types of video data. Due to the fact that social media platforms
such as YouTube and TikTok encourage users to contribute videos, there has been
a surge in the amount of user-generated video content.
Companies are keeping a careful eye on this emerging trend and have also
increased the number of videos they use to promote their products. The
application of video content analytics can, in fact, provide businesses with
additional avenues for assessing crucial key performance metrics for video
assets that are shared on social media channels. First, let's take a look at a
few examples from real life, and then we'll go over some of the known
applications of video analytics in the business world.
Healthcare organizations have been spending considerable sums of money on video
surveillance technologies for many years now. The necessity of doing this lies
in the fact that it ensures the safety of its patients, staff, and visitors at
levels that are frequently governed by stringent legislation. It is now common
practice for healthcare organizations to implement video content analytics.
In addition to making surveillance jobs easier to complete, video analytics
enables us to investigate the data that has been acquired in order to achieve
our business objectives. Using video analytics, for instance, a system may
identify instances in which a patient has not been checked on in accordance
with their requirements and then notify the personnel.
The growth of smart cities worldwide is being aided by video content analytics,
which is proven to be dependable in the field of transportation. A surge in
traffic, particularly in urban areas, can result in an increase in the number
of accidents and traffic jams if proper measures to regulate traffic are not
followed. Within the context of this circumstance, intelligent video analysis
tools may prove to be beneficial.
The ability to dynamically change traffic signal control systems and monitor
traffic bottlenecks is now something that we can rely on and rely on traffic
analysis. Detecting potentially hazardous circumstances in real time, such as a
car that has stopped in an area that is not authorized on the highway, is
another potential application of this technology.
Certain video analytics tools are now able to identify inappropriate activities
exhibited by pedestrians on street videos and are also capable of processing
large amounts of data. Because of this, we are able to take action in locations
where there is a high volume of delinquent behavior that is causing traffic
problems.
